Facilities and Amenities

The Bridgwater Train Station is equipped with a staffed ticket office operational between 06:30 and 14:15 from Monday to Saturday. For those purchasing tickets online, the station provides accessible ticket machines to collect your tickets with ease. An induction loop is also available, ensuring clear communication.

Though staff help isn’t directly on hand, Bridgwater offers help points with access to departure screens and live announcements. CCTV is in operation for added security throughout the station. If cycling to the station, enjoy ample bicycle storage options with spaces available on both Platform 1 and 2.

While there are no shops, refreshments, or ATMs on-site, the station ensures basic comforts with a waiting room open parallel to the ticket office hours on Platform 2. Baby changing facilities are also on hand, yet be informed that the station lacks accessible toilets and a first-class lounge.

Accessibility and Transport Links

Navigating the station is relatively easy with step-free access to all platforms, classified as a category B2 for accessibility. However, be mindful that full step-free access between platforms isn't available. For motorists, the adjacent car park operates 24 hours with spaces to accommodate 36 vehicles, including accessible spaces.

Considering onward travel? Bridgwater boasts connections with local taxi services like Beeline Taxis. Regional bus services extend from the station, optimizing your travel routes. For those venturing further afield, connections via Reading open pathways to major airports like Heathrow.

Station Facilities and Amenities

At Rotherhithe Station, passengers have access to necessary ticket purchasing and collection facilities. With ticket machines available along with the capability to collect tickets bought online, your travel plans can continue without a hitch. The ticket office is operational from 07:30 to 10:00 from Monday to Friday. For those who require additional assistance, step-free access is available, except for a few steps from the foot of the escalator to platform level.

While the station doesn’t boast extensive amenities like a waiting room or refreshment facilities, it ensures basic needs with the availability of smartcard validators and induction loops for accessibility. However, travelers should note the absence of luggage storage and accessible toilets. The station is equipped with CCTV for safety and a modest bicycle storage area for cyclists.

Onward Travel Options

Rotherhithe Station connects well with other transport networks that facilitate swift movement across London. Rail replacement services link to various parts of the city, with bus stop Y catering to southbound travels to New Cross and bus stop D at Canada Water bus station handling northbound services towards Dalston.

If you wish to journey via the Jubilee Line, Canada Water is just one stop south—making the Underground easily accessible. Moreover, those flying in or out of London have easy access to London City Airport through connections available at Shadwell via the Docklands Light Railway.
